NO SHOW SYDNEY

It comes to my notice that competition horses, not racehorses, in Victoria are still making the brunt of the sacrifices to protect our state from EI. Read the Sydney Show press release, horses either have to be vaccinated or have a blood test to prove their immunity, and be micro chipped to compete. Where does this leave Victorian horses, when the DPI and the racing authorities have snaffled all available vaccine and are not permitting competition horses to be done?? What other shows north of the border are going to follow suite, and how many years will this be enforced?? I have it in writing from Minister Joe Helper that 'there currently is NO legislated standstill in Victoria.' Why then, have all the shows in Victoria bowed under pressure and cancelled(except Ian Mouser at Tonimbuk, and the EFA showjumping committee). What laws run the show if the government doesn't? It will probably sound insane, but MAYBE in the long run, we would have been better off to have got EI!! Most would have then been vaccinated, certainly the race horses would have remained un effected!, and we would be soon getting on with our life again. If only we had a crystal ball?

JANE( ex Victorian Showie)
